All processes (the main process started by you and the child processes) will write to disk, often a significant amount of data. You will have to make sure that the scratch space used by all these tasks is both big and fast enough. Use the environment variables SCM_TMPDIR and SCM_USETMPDIR to tell the ADF programs where to create their scratch directories.
In the next few sections we will explain exactly what these variables do.
→ Set the SCM_TMPDIR and SCM_USETMPDIR environment variables.
Example:
